Nell, the Surrey History Centre kindly gave me these details of her marriage in Surrey:
***** Henry Tudgey bachelor of this parish and Elizabeth Ann Retford spinster of this parish were married in this church [St Mary’s] by Banns with consent of _____ this eighth Day of June in the Year One Thousand eight hundred and twenty nine By me Thomas Hatch Vicar This marriage was solemized between Henry Tudgey [he had signed with a ‘X’] and Elizabeth Ann Retford [she has signed her name] In the Presence of George Cook, J Wilkins, [--?--] and Robert Rogerson” *****
I've got her death as 1881 in Leatherhead, Surrey, and think she was born in Milton, Hampshire in 1809.
Her parents could be Moses RETFORD and Elizabeth, but I'm not certain of this.
Elizabeth Ann could sign her own name, so her family might have been well-educated. I have read that a later RETFORD in the area was a maker of bows for musical instruments.
I'd like to be sure of her parents, and siblings, and to know, if I could, something of their occupations and how far back the family goes in Hampshire. A big ask, I guess. Any help would be much appreciated.

OK let's do the census
1851 HO107/1593/37 p6 Manor Place Walton on Thames
Elizabeth Tudgy Married 42 b Milton Hampshire Jane Tudgy daughter 18 dressmaker b Walton on Thames Alfred Thomas Tudgy son 11 scholar b Walton on Thames Mary Ann Emily Tudgy daughter 7 b Walton on Thames Edward Tudgy son 4 scholar b Walton on Thames
Henry is at HO107/1593/45 p 22 Dairy Farm in Walton on Thames (near Oatlands Park). A Farm servant, born Hound, Hampshire, age 47
1861
Mary Ann is a servant in Walton on Thames RG9/421/48 p37 at the Beaches, home of lawyer James Blenkinsop. No sign of Henry, Alfred or Jane. Edward appaears as the stepson of Richard Crockford! Richard married Elizabeth Ann Tudgy December qtr 1859 Kingston RD. Elizabeth Tudgy dying in 1881 may not be yours!
RG9/421/9 p 12 Common Side Walton on Thames
Richard Crockford Head 38 Garden Labourer b Effingham Elizabeth A Crockford wife 57 b Ashley Hampshire Edward Tudgy stepson 14 scholar b Walton Mary Crockford sister 46 b Effingham
In 1871 Richard is in Leatherhead RG10/800/14 p 19 Downs Cottages Richard Crockford 48 Labourer b Effingham Elizabeth Crockford 60 b Milton Hampshire John Keene nurse child 1 yr b London plus 2 lodgers
Edward Tudgey is now in Hallow in Worcestershire, working as a gardener, married.
1881 sees the pair still in Leatherhead RG11/763/18 p 30 Downs Cottages Richard Crockford Head 57 Garden Labourer b Effingham Elizabeth Crockford wife 70 b Milton Hampshire Emily Tudgy daughter 37 unmarried b Hersham John Keene visitor 11 scholar b Lambeth Constance Howard boarder 7 b Blackheath Kent
Elizabeth Ann Crockford died age 73 in Epsom RD Sept 1881 2a 19.
But what happened to Henry - I can't find a death for him a the moment.
